From 77b284e6988b9a131d6abb3140ec6663c2ae84ae Mon Sep 17 00:00:00 2001 From: Jim Flynn Date: Sun, 13 Mar 2022 20:53:35 +0000 Subject: IVGCVSW-6848 Move Process.[ch]pp from armnnUtils to profiling/common Change-Id: I13353f50293eae565a75ccfda37209350512bbc6 Signed-off-by: Jim Flynn --- src/armnn/LoadedNetwork.cpp | 14 ++++++++----- src/armnn/test/RuntimeTests.cpp | 15 ++++++++------ src/armnnUtils/Processes.cpp | 29 --------------------------- src/armnnUtils/Processes.hpp | 16 --------------- src/profiling/SendCounterPacket.cpp | 5 ++--- src/profiling/SendThread.cpp | 3 --- src/profiling/test/ProfilingTestUtils.cpp | 4 ++-- src/profiling/test/SendCounterPacketTests.cpp | 4 ++-- 8 files changed, 24 insertions(+), 66 deletions(-) delete mode 100644 src/armnnUtils/Processes.cpp delete mode 100644 src/armnnUtils/Processes.hpp (limited to 'src') diff --git a/src/armnn/LoadedNetwork.cpp b/src/armnn/LoadedNetwork.cpp index 46c1ce58aa..a720769873 100644 --- a/src/armnn/LoadedNetwork.cpp +++ b/src/armnn/LoadedNetwork.cpp @@ -6,22 +6,26 @@ #include "LoadedNetwork.hpp" #include "Layer.hpp" #include "Graph.hpp" -#include #include "Profiling.hpp" #include "HeapProfiling.hpp" #include "WorkingMemHandle.hpp" +#include #include #include -#include #include #include #include -#include -#include + #include +#include + +#include + +#include + #include namespace armnn @@ -262,7 +266,7 @@ LoadedNetwork::LoadedNetwork(std::unique_ptr net, // Mark the network with a start of life event timelineUtils->RecordEvent(networkGuid, LabelsAndEventClasses::ARMNN_PROFILING_SOL_EVENT_CLASS); // and with the process ID - int processID = armnnUtils::Processes::GetCurrentId(); + int processID = arm::pipe::GetCurrentId(); std::stringstream ss; ss << processID; timelineUtils->MarkEntityWithLabel(networkGuid, ss.str(), LabelsAndEventClasses::PROCESS_ID_GUID); diff --git a/src/armnn/test/RuntimeTests.cpp b/src/armnn/test/RuntimeTests.cpp index 89a87197bd..fc16dbbad9 100644 --- a/src/armnn/test/RuntimeTests.cpp +++ b/src/armnn/test/RuntimeTests.cpp @@ -3,17 +3,20 @@ // SPDX-License-Identifier: MIT // -#include -#include -#include -#include #include #include -#include #include + +#include +#include +#include #include +#include + #include +#include + #include #include @@ -733,7 +736,7 @@ TEST_CASE("ProfilingEnableCpuRef") offset); // Process ID Label - int processID = armnnUtils::Processes::GetCurrentId(); + int processID = arm::pipe::GetCurrentId(); std::stringstream ss; ss << processID; std::string processIdLabel = ss.str(); diff --git a/src/armnnUtils/Processes.cpp b/src/armnnUtils/Processes.cpp deleted file mode 100644 index 8b401d4145..0000000000 --- a/src/armnnUtils/Processes.cpp +++ /dev/null @@ -1,29 +0,0 @@ -// -// Copyright © 2020 Arm Ltd and Contributors. All rights reserved. -// SPDX-License-Identifier: MIT -// - -#include "Processes.hpp" - -#if defined(__unix__) || defined(__APPLE__) -#include -#elif defined(_MSC_VER) -#include -#endif - -namespace armnnUtils -{ -namespace Processes -{ - -int GetCurrentId() -{ -#if defined(__unix__) || defined(__APPLE__) - return getpid(); -#elif defined(_MSC_VER) - return ::GetCurrentProcessId(); -#endif -} - -} -} diff --git a/src/armnnUtils/Processes.hpp b/src/armnnUtils/Processes.hpp deleted file mode 100644 index 89704237db..0000000000 --- a/src/armnnUtils/Processes.hpp +++ /dev/null @@ -1,16 +0,0 @@ -// -// Copyright © 2020 Arm Ltd and Contributors. All rights reserved. -// SPDX-License-Identifier: MIT -// - -#pragma once - -namespace armnnUtils -{ -namespace Processes -{ - -int GetCurrentId(); - -} -} diff --git a/src/profiling/SendCounterPacket.cpp b/src/profiling/SendCounterPacket.cpp index 4586d9acb8..d354d40aca 100644 --- a/src/profiling/SendCounterPacket.cpp +++ b/src/profiling/SendCounterPacket.cpp @@ -9,11 +9,10 @@ #include #include #include +#include #include #include -#include - #include #include @@ -110,7 +109,7 @@ void SendCounterPacket::SendStreamMetaDataPacket() offset += sizeUint32; WriteUint32(writeBuffer, offset, MAX_METADATA_PACKET_LENGTH); // max_data_length offset += sizeUint32; - int pid = armnnUtils::Processes::GetCurrentId(); + int pid = arm::pipe::GetCurrentId(); WriteUint32(writeBuffer, offset, arm::pipe::numeric_cast(pid)); // pid offset += sizeUint32; uint32_t poolOffset = bodySize; diff --git a/src/profiling/SendThread.cpp b/src/profiling/SendThread.cpp index 1459ae5499..7fb8e659f5 100644 --- a/src/profiling/SendThread.cpp +++ b/src/profiling/SendThread.cpp @@ -7,11 +7,8 @@ #include "ProfilingUtils.hpp" #include - #include -#include - #include namespace arm diff --git a/src/profiling/test/ProfilingTestUtils.cpp b/src/profiling/test/ProfilingTestUtils.cpp index a6ec66da2f..2cd20b4716 100644 --- a/src/profiling/test/ProfilingTestUtils.cpp +++ b/src/profiling/test/ProfilingTestUtils.cpp @@ -11,13 +11,13 @@ #include #include -#include #include #include #include #include #include +#include #include @@ -492,7 +492,7 @@ void VerifyPostOptimisationStructureTestImpl(armnn::BackendId backendId) offset); // Process ID Label - int processID = armnnUtils::Processes::GetCurrentId(); + int processID = arm::pipe::GetCurrentId(); std::stringstream ss; ss << processID; std::string processIdLabel = ss.str(); diff --git a/src/profiling/test/SendCounterPacketTests.cpp b/src/profiling/test/SendCounterPacketTests.cpp index 4ae2c5562b..abd4cee600 100644 --- a/src/profiling/test/SendCounterPacketTests.cpp +++ b/src/profiling/test/SendCounterPacketTests.cpp @@ -11,7 +11,6 @@ #include #include #include -#include #include @@ -20,6 +19,7 @@ #include #include #include +#include #include #include @@ -365,7 +365,7 @@ TEST_CASE("SendStreamMetaDataPacketTest") offset += sizeUint32; CHECK(ReadUint32(readBuffer2, offset) == MAX_METADATA_PACKET_LENGTH); // max_data_len offset += sizeUint32; - int pid = armnnUtils::Processes::GetCurrentId(); + int pid = arm::pipe::GetCurrentId(); CHECK(ReadUint32(readBuffer2, offset) == arm::pipe::numeric_cast(pid)); offset += sizeUint32; uint32_t poolOffset = 10 * sizeUint32; -- cgit v1.2.1